Rebel Risotto

Julia Savory
Breaking tradition, this risotto is made with all the stock added at once – ideal for low-water or campervan cooking. It's a very easy dish and a good introduction to risotto though not cooked in the classic way. With celery added to lighten the texture and add crunch, this is light and easy to digest. Zesty with lemon, it’s as good for a special dinner as it is for a quick midweek meal.

Ingredients
  

Ingredients for the risotto

  • 160 g brown onion | unpeeled weight; peeled and sliced into petals
  • 15 ml rapeseed oil
  • 1 pinch salt
  • 100 g celery | diced at a size to taste; larger = more rustic, smaller = more fine dining
  • 10 g stock cube
  • 600 ml water
  • 15 g butter
  • 160 g risotto rice
  • 15 ml lemon juice
  • 1 clove fresh garlic | grated
  • salt | to taste
  • ground black pepper | to taste

Ingredients for the topping

  • 128 g cherry tomatoes
  • 5 ml olive oil
  • 1 pinch salt
  • 15 ml balsamic vinegar

Ingredients for the salad dressing

  • 1 tbsp red wine vinegar
  • 1 pinch salt
  • 2 tbsp extra virgin oil
  • ½ tsp maple syrup | or agave syrup
  • 1 pinch ground black pepper

To serve

  • salad leaves
  • lemon | wedges and zest
  • fresh parsley | neatly chopped
  • fresh basil or fresh rocket | optional

Instructions
 

Prepare the onion

  • Peel and finely chop the onion
    160 g brown onion
  • Cook the onion in some oil with a pinch of salt on very low to make it soft, translucent and caramelised.
    15 ml rapeseed oil, 1 pinch salt
  • Chop the celery and make up the stock.
    100 g celery, 10 g stock cube, 600 ml water

Cook the rice, add the butter

  • Add the butter and melt it completely. Add the rice and toast the rice in the butter.
    15 g butter, 160 g risotto rice
  • Add the lemon juice. Stir.
    15 ml lemon juice
  • Pour in the stock and stir. Adjust seasoning. Put a lid on and cook on a low heat.
    Check the risotto every few minutes.

Add the other ingredients

  • Grate in the garlic and add the celery. The garlic will infuse the risotto with flavour and the celery will give bite and lighten the starchy load on the palate.
    1 clove fresh garlic
  • Stir and put the lid back on, and cook on a low heat. When it's finished cooking, the rice grains should have a tiny bit of bite to them, just at the centre; you don't want puffed up 'blown' rice.
    Check the seasoning.
    salt

Tomatoes and plating

  • In oil, cook the tomatoes, adding some salt.
    128 g cherry tomatoes, 5 ml olive oil, 1 pinch salt
  • Add the balsamic vinegar.
    15 ml balsamic vinegar

To serve

  • Make the salad dressing: dissolve the salt in the vinegar, and then add the remaining ingredients.
    1 tbsp red wine vinegar, 1 pinch salt, 2 tbsp extra virgin oil, ½ tsp maple syrup, 1 pinch ground black pepper
  • Carefully spoon some risotto into a bowl, add some salad leaves on the side, a wedge of lemon and some chopped parsley. Zest a lemon is a final touch!
    salad leaves, lemon, fresh parsley

Notes

  • This reheats OK, not great, but definitely edible!
  • You could drizzle over some extra virgin olive oil but really, it might get a little greasy.
  • Any remaining herbs: chop up and put into storage boxes and pop into the fridge. I find supermarket herbs prepped and stored this way last a fair few days.
